Do you see Kristen Wiig and Bill Murray as a couple? While it certain seems unlikely on paper, it’s hardly the first time that Hollywood has tried to put together people of differing ages.

And in the case of new comedy movie ‘Epiphany,’ the unlikeliness of the union is both being leaned into and mined for laughs.

According to Variety, ‘Saturday Night Live’ veterans (albeit of very different eras) Kristen Wiig and Bill Murray have already worked on the movie, which was directed by Max Barbakow, who rose to prominence with the excellent Andy Samberg/Cristin Milioti time-loop comedy ‘Palm Springs’ and more recently made Josh Brolin/Peter Dinklage sibling comedy ‘Brothers.’

Unlike his previous movies which he at least co-wrote, ‘Epiphany,’ which is now in the post-production stage, comes from a script by Mitch Glazer.

That name should ring bells to anyone with a passing knowledge of Murray’s filmography, since Glazer met the actor years ago during Murray’s ‘SNL’ days, and the two became close friends while working on ‘Scrooged,’ which Glazer wrote with Murray starring.

Since then they’ve worked together off and on –– Glazer produced ‘Lost in Translation’ and wrote 2015 comedy ‘Rock the Kasbah’ for the actor.

‘Epiphany’ follows Favorite Ives (Wiig), an heiress and fashionista who has blown through her entire fortune and is forced to take up a challenge: marry a rich husband in two weeks or lose everything and end up on the street.

Her desperate search for a big-money mark slams her into eccentric math savant and billionaire Oz Bell (Murray). Favorite needs Oz’s money and Oz craves Favorite’s spirit and spontaneity. Can this unlikely couple find something more?

Wiig had a couple of roles last year –– she reprised her voice performance as Lucy in ‘ Despicable Me 4’ and appeared as herself (while writing and performing the theme song) in documentary ‘Will & Harper.’

She also had the lead in Apple TV+ comedy drama ‘Palm Royale,’ about a woman desperately trying to gain admittance and social standing in a snooty Miami club in the late 1960s. A second season of the show is in the works and should be on screens this year. On top of that, she reprised another animated role, that of anthropomorphic hot dog bun Brenda in ‘Sausage Party: Foodtopia’ on Prime Video.

There are also a few projects on her To Do list, including a remake of German comedy drama ‘Toni Erdmann’ and a movie written with her ‘Bridesmaids’ collaborator Annie Mumolo that focuses on Cinderella’s evil stepsisters.

Murray is harder to pin down since he prefers to only work when he feels like it. Though he’s been fairly consistent, despite lingering accusations of inappropriate behavior on set, which got Aziz Ansari’s ‘Being Mortal’ thrown into shutdown limbo.

He works most usually for director Wes Anderson and is once more part of the cast for the director’s next film, ‘The Phoenician Scheme,’ which will be in theaters on June 6th.

Last year, Murray was seen in the likes of ‘Ghostbusters: Frozen Empire’ (once more playing the role of Peter Venkman), ‘The Friend’ opposite Naomi Watts in the story of a woman who adopts a Great Dane that belonged to her late mentor and ‘Riff Raff,’ which sees a former criminal’s life turned upside down when his family shows up for a reunion.

When will ‘Epiphany’ be in theaters?

So far, the movie doesn’t have a distribution home in the States or overseas –– the rights will be for sale at the European Film Market in Berlin this week –– so any talk of a release date is, at this stage, premature.

With the movie already shot, the appeal of both the leads and Barbakow as director should help drive interest.
